From f317a6c2eb0ba8bffb6d42bf159e18c0163fdfa9 Mon Sep 17 00:00:00 2001 From: ryoppippi <1560508+ryoppippi@users.noreply.github.com> Date: Tue, 10 Jan 2023 16:04:35 +0900 Subject: [PATCH] add svelte and vue support --- index.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/index.js b/index.js index 0d9de9d..8222848 100644 --- a/index.js +++ b/index.js @@ -16,7 +16,12 @@ const give = (data) => const init = async () => { const [path, filetype] = process.argv.slice(2); - const lang = filetype[0] === "t" ? Lang.TYPESCRIPT : Lang.JAVASCRIPT; + const lang = (() => { + if (filetype === "svelte") return Lang.SVELTE; + if (filetype === "vue") return Lang.VUE; + if (filetype[0] === "t") return Lang.TYPESCRIPT; + return Lang.JAVASCRIPT; + })(); const contents = await receive(); const emitter = importCost(path, contents, lang);